According to Stratistics MRC, the Global Lycopene Market is accounted for $142.6 million in 2024 and is expected to reach $218.9 million by 2030 growing at a CAGR of 7.4% during the forecast period. Lycopene is a naturally occurring pigment responsible for the red color in fruits and vegetables, particularly tomatoes, watermelon, and pink grapefruit. It belongs to the carotenoid family, which are potent antioxidants. Lycopene is notable for its health benefits, primarily for its potential role in reducing the risk of certain chronic diseases, including cancer and cardiovascular diseases. As an antioxidant, it helps neutralize harmful free radicals in the body, thus protecting cells from damage.
According to World Health Organization (WHO), cancer is a leading cause of death globally, accounting for nearly 10 million deaths in 2020. According to American Academy of Dermatology (AAD) Association, 197,700 new cases of melanoma are expected to be detected in the U.S. in 2022, with 97,920 being noninvasive (in situ) and 99,780 being invasive.

Advancements in extraction technologies
Advancements in extraction technologies are revolutionizing the lycopene market by enabling more efficient and cost-effective extraction processes. Traditional methods often involved heat, solvents, and lengthy procedures, leading to degradation of lycopene and increased production costs. Modern extraction techniques, such as supercritical fluid extraction (SFE) and ultrasound-assisted extraction (UAE), offer higher yields, greater purity, and reduced processing times. SFE employs supercritical carbon dioxide to extract lycopene without the use of harmful solvents, preserving its integrity and nutritional value.
Seasonal variations
Seasonal changes such as temperature fluctuations and irregular rainfall patterns, can disrupt tomato cultivation, leading to inconsistent yields and quality. This inconsistency in the tomato supply chain directly affects lycopene production, causing fluctuations in market availability and pricing. Additionally, seasonal variations may also affect the nutritional content of tomatoes, influencing the concentration of lycopene within them. Consequently, industries reliant on lycopene, such as pharmaceuticals, nutraceuticals, and food processing, face challenges in maintaining stable production and meeting consumer demand.

The Synthetic Lycopene segment is expected to be the largest during the forecast period
Synthetic Lycopene segment is expected to be the largest during the forecast period. Synthetic lycopene, produced through advanced biotechnological processes, provides a more reliable and consistent supply compared to natural sources like tomatoes or watermelons, which can be affected by seasonal variations and environmental factors. Moreover, synthetic lycopene ensures higher purity levels, free from contaminants often present in natural extracts. The scalability of synthetic production facilitates cost-effectiveness and promotes market accessibility, meeting the growing demand for lycopene-based products worldwide.

In December 2022, Anglo French Drugs & Industries Limited, which is a 99-year-old pharmaceutical company, entered the fertility market with the launch of LYBER Range, which includes LYBER-M, LYBER-PCO, and LYBER+. LYBER-M is an antioxidant combination including Co-Enzyme Q10, Astaxanthin, Lycopene, L-Carnitine, and Zinc that improves testosterone levels, sperm count, concentration, and motility, and helps to reduce sperm DNA damage.
In January 2022, Lycored, a lycopene and carotenoids ingredient provider, launched a processing plant in Branchburg, NJ for its carotenoids, vitamins, minerals, amino acids, and genuine food components. This new factory allows the firm to maximize quality, potency, and shelf-stability of its chemicals while expanding output capacity dramatically. It has superior milling, mixing, drying, and coating capabilities, as well as several customizable options.
